Ryzen 5 4500U vs A6-5200 comparison

In our benchmarks, the Ryzen 5 4500U beats the A6-5200 in overall performance. Furthermore, our gaming benchmark shows that it also outperforms the A6-5200 in all gaming tests too.

With info from our database, we find that the Ryzen 5 4500U has significantly more cores with 6 cores whereas the A6-5200 has 4 cores. It also has more threads than the A6-5200. These CPUs have different clock speeds. Indeed, the Ryzen 5 4500U has a slightly higher clock speed compared to the A6-5200. A Ryzen 5 4500U CPU outputs less heat than a A6-5200 CPU because of its significantly lower TDP. This measures the amount of heat they output and can be used to estimate power consumption. The info from our database shows that the Ryzen 5 4500U has more L2 cache than the A6-5200
